This specimen was lot 1207 in Sincona sale 85 (Zürich, October 2023), where it sold for 800 CHF (about US$1,077 including buyer's fees). The catalog description[1] noted,

"IRAN, Sultan Ahmad Shah, 1327-1344 AH (1909-1925). 1 Toman 1341 AH (1922/1923 AD), Tehran Mint. Bust type with collar. NGC MS64+. Magnificent condition. From the Kian collection, auction SINCONA 49, October 2018, lot 232. Finest certified by NGC."

This type was struck AH 1332-1343 during the reign of Ahmad Shah (r. 1909-25).

Recorded mintage: unknown.

Specification: 2.87 g, 0.900 fine gold, this specimen 2.87 g.

Catalog reference: KM 1074 var. Fr-84.
